The percentage of people who own at least one credit card increases every year but there again, credit card debt is also at a record high as well; this situation is the result of years of easy living on credit. Very few people that can say they owe nothing on them and as a consequence these finance companies are now owed thousands of dollars on most of the cards that have been issued, unfortunately people are only now beginning to realize that the damage has been done. Unfortunately, by the time many people realize just how bad the situation is, a credit card debt relief answer might not be possible.

At this point it is important to start as you mean to go on and stop all spending on the card otherwise it will make arranging a debt relief plan much harder to implement. Making the decision can be the hardest part but no-one said credit card debt relief would be easy. The three debt consolidation plans detailed below are going to be your best options although they are by no means the only one available.

Where a person in financial trouble is still able to apply for a credit card, then by obtaining one that offers a low rate of interest the debts can be consolidated leaving just one payment to make regularly until the debt is cleared. If this method is not available then a consolidation loan may be a debt relief answer where a number of debts can be replaced with just one at a lower monthly instalments.

Once this amount has been agreed, the person with the debts must ensure the payments are made in full each month until the balance is clear. This particular route is only viable if the person with the debt retains a good credit history and they have the means to pay back the loan once the debts are clear.

When the situation or poor credit rating occurs, credit card debt relief is unlikely; then it will probably be necessary to contact a company that specializes in negotiating settlements. Normally, when these negotiations proceed approximately half the debt will need to be paid and the remainder to be written off by the creditors.

If all else fails the debtor is left with bankruptcy to clear the debts but this is not something that should ever be looked upon as the first course of action as there are serious consequences to be considered. The debts may be clear but they will find it hard to get any form of credit for a long time and will have to rebuild their credit history from scratch although it does enable them to have a fresh start. These options should be considered as a once only relief from credit card debt because lessons need to be learnt so the situation does not happen again.
